What Is ADX?
The NAS Aeronautical Data Exchange (ADX) is a portal-based "data-mart" tailored to distribute aeronautical related data to FAA employees, contractors, and DoD personnel.
ADX is designed to provide a data-centric approach for querying and obtaining data; providing users an efficient means to obtain information with relative ease.
What Services Does ADX Provide?
Data Product Access
- Adaptation Information
- Aeronautical Information
Data Services
- Custom Queries/Filters
- Product Change Notification
- Web UI or Web Service
Community and Collaboration Based Services
